Resolution on Russia and the case of Alexei Navalny

Summary

The European Parliament condemns the politically motivated sentencing of Alexei Navalny and his brother, calling for an end to the crackdown on civil society in Russia.

Key points

  • Condemnation of the legal proceedings against Alexei Navalny and his brother Oleg Navalny, which are viewed as politically motivated.
  • Concerns regarding the lack of judicial independence and the failure to uphold constitutional standards in Russia.
  • The suppression of the right to freedom of assembly and expression.
  • Criticism of the use of 'foreign agent' legislation to target and dismantle independent human rights organizations like Memorial.
